Transaction 8e5fab98461970f75cfc69fdb3a12ec750b518517a707dcebbfa2431cbb51fec

1 Input
2 Outputs
  • 8e5fab98461970f75cfc69fdb3a12ec750b518517a707dcebbfa2431cbb51fec:0
  • value  144361
    address  15SFSMtvALNp3LnKxMoAcgt8gSJQfjkwnb
  • 8e5fab98461970f75cfc69fdb3a12ec750b518517a707dcebbfa2431cbb51fec:1
  • value  404634779
    address  1zgmvYi5x1wy3hUh7AjKgpcVgpA8Lj9FA